An Interview with Connie Porcher

Now, tell me all about your newsletter, Celebrate threesixtyfive

I felt there was a big void in mailed newsletters following the final issue of Glitter. I had some time and I knew I wanted something to occupy my time in a productive way. I also wanted something that would be stimulating. I have some journalism and writing in my background, so I thought why not give it try! Genette Fuller and I worked together for the first three issues.

The newsletter debuted in October, 1999. (Genette Fuller was a partner for the first three issues) It is mailed out on a quarterly schedule and has approximately 40 pages that cover all ornaments -- but the majority are glass.

The excellent covers have been done by Bev Verbeke of Dallas. Scott Smith has also worked on the newsletter. He did the Larry Fraga layout in the last issue, a four-page color center spread of Patricia Breen Saints and religious ornaments for the Christmas issue.

Subscription is $48. per year, and sample copies can be purchased for $12.
